MidiDroide Custom

This application allows you to create custom designs for their own Controllers Midi / OSC (Wi-Fi).
– Two custom-designed screens (Scene 1/2).
– Fixed a screen design (Demo).
– Design Editor Incorporated.
– Midi / OSC configurable events.
– Support design available when WiFi is connected.
– Fader  progress values can be saved.

“Demo” “Scene_1” Example

 

        Editor

     Add Button / Fader and Setting Parameters to create your own custom-designed screen.


–  Save all your Desings.


– Delete  Button / Fader from your desings.

– Drag and Drop: choose the buttons / fader location on the screen.

     – Expand Button:  Keep clicking on Button to resize it (using two-fingers touch scale gesture).

     – Rotate Fader. Touch Fader and rotate (using two-fingers touch scale gesture)

     –  RESTORE DEFAULT: Delete your own design  (Scene 1/2)

          Close Editor



  Wi Fi

– Connect to OSC  (IP+ Port).

– Connect to MidiServer  ( MidiDroide Tutorial).

Protocol MIDI/OSC:

MIDI :

           “Demo” – default Midi Menssage :

Note/CC Channel 1

           “Scene_1/Scene_2” (custom desing):

                   –  Set parameters:

Midi Channel (1 to 16)
Midi Number (1 to 127).

                   –  Not set parameters (default):

Midi Channel =  1
Midi Number =  automatic –

 OSC :

            “Demo” – default OSC Menssage:

  – Implements default “String Address” to MidiBox128  (MIOS32 app).

  – Note Events: /<chn>/note <key-number> <velocity>

  – CC Events: /<chn>/cc <cc-number> <cc-value>

 “Scene_1/Scene_2” (custom desing):

 –  Set parameters:

– String Address =”/osc/midi1/”  (example)
Arguments =  float 0.0 to 1.0 for Fader / int 1 int 0 for Button.

                   –  Not set parameters (default):

– OSC String Address =  idem “Demo” (MidiBox128).
– OSC Arguments  =  idem “Demo” (MidiBox128).

Download Google Play:

  MidiDroide Custom Tablet
         - Requirements: Android 4.0 or later - Tablet 10 ".

MidiDroide – Android Midi (Wi Fi)

MidiDroide es una aplicación para Android que nos permite utilizar los dispositivos como “Controladores Midi Wi-Fi”. La aplicación se comunica con la PC (vía Wi-Fi) y los datos son interpretados por “MidiServer”,este programa está hecho en Java y se encarga de enviar Midi a los dispositivos que tengamos en nuestro sistema (Window/Mac). “MidiServer” es multi-cliente por lo que permite conectar todos los “MidiDroides” que queramos!

Video de prueba MidiDroide (Motorola Milestone) – MidiDroide Tablet (Motorola Xoom) – Ableton Live:

MidiDroide Tablet soporta independiente Multi-Touch!

Captura Pantalla Controlador – MidiDroide Tablet Captura Pantalla Pad – MidiDroide Tablet
Esta aplicación para Android está disponible gratis en Google Play:
  MidiDroide (Android Versión 2.1 o superior).
  MidiDroide Tablet (Android Versión 3.0 o superior,Tablet 10").

Tutorial:

-Descarga y ejecuta  MidiServer (requiere:Java). Usuarios de Mac leer .


-Descarga “MidiDroide” en tu dispositivo. En “Menu” -“Wi Fi” – “Conexión” introduce IP que te indica “MidiServer” – tildar “Conectado”.

-MidiServer permite conectarnos con los dispositivos Midi que tengamos instalados en nuestro sistema, para enviar Midi a otro programa (ej. Ableton Live) debemos instalar un “Virtual Midi Driver” : recomiendo “LoopBe1.”

-Configuración con Ableton Live:

– En “MidiServer”- “Midi Device” – tildamos “LoopBe External Midi Port” .

Estas aplicaciones fueron probadas en los diferentes dispositivos que nos ofrece RTL (Remote Test Lab) de Samsung : Galaxy Note- Galaxy S2- Galaxy Tab 10.1 – Galaxy Nexus (Android 4.0 instalar “MidiDroide”,ver 2.1). Esta versión de MidiDroide Tablet está optimizada para pantallas de 10″ , para otros tamaños instalar MidiDroide.

En futuras actualizaciones se incluirán más Pantallas de Controles (se aceptan ideas y diseños).

 

Actualización:

  • MidiDroide Tablet 1.1.apk – Se corrige visibilidad de ActionBar para Android 4 – (Desinstalar Versiones  anteriores).
  • Nuevo MidiServer.

MidiDroide Tablet Android 4

TouchScreen para Video Juegos

Manejo del Mouse con Pantalla Táctil Resistiva y emulación del Keyboard por medio de pulsadores,seteados como las 4 flechas del teclado (arriba,abajo,izq,der.).
Utilización del Descriptor “usb_desc_kbmouse.h” del CCS. (Dispositivo Compuesto USB).
 PIC 18F2550.
Código Detalles

Controlador MIDI USB 32

Este controlador utiliza  los módulos expansores  AIN, DIN, DOUT de MidiBox.( 32 Potes,Teclas y Leds)

PIC 18f2550 como “Core” de MidiBox . El código está escrito con Proton Basic y se puede descargar aqui

Caoss Synth y MIDIbox SID v1.73

Pruebas con el famoso sintetizador (SID 6581) de la Commodore 64.
Controlado por el maravilloso “Mios” (ucapps.de) y Midi enviado por Caoss Synth.
Descripción Caoss Synth :
– 2 Octavas , una octava para el sensor de movimiento y otra para la ” touch”.
– 4 Escalas: Mayor ,Española, Pentatonica Mayor y Pentatonica Menor.
– Tónica seleccionable.
– Seleccion de 8 patch.
– Envia evento CC (17) con sensor de movimiento.
– Ajuste de sensibilidad de la Touch Screen.

CAOSS – Controlador MIDI USB con Pantalla Táctil

Controlador Midi Usb con Matriz de Led, Pantalla Táctil Resistiva y Sensor de distancia tipo Sharp GP2D.
detalles del proyecto aqui

Tema original

Código en “C” para el Pic.

TouchScreen USB – Trackpad

Pruebas con pantalla táctil resistiva de 5 hilos conectada a un pic 18F2550, utilizando Descriptor USB Mouse. Simula el trackpad de notebook, realizando las 4 funciones basicas;  eje_X , ejeY, rueda, doble click.

Codigo; http://www.todopic.com.ar/foros/index.php?topic=31768.0

A %d blogueros les gusta esto: